Technical Specifications

Side-by-side comparison of Ryzen 3 PRO 3300U and Opteron 6378

AMD

Ryzen 3 PRO 3300U

The Ryzen 3 PRO 3300U is manufactured by AMD. It was released in 8 April 2019 (6 years ago). It is based on the Picasso (2019−2022) architecture. It features 4 cores and 4 threads. Base frequency is 2.1 GHz, with boost up to 3.5 GHz. L3 cache: 4 MB (total). L2 cache: 512K (per core). Built on 12 nm process technology. Socket: FP5. Thermal design power (TDP): 15 Watt. Memory support: DDR4 Dual-channel. Passmark benchmark score: 5,831 points. Launch price was $149.

AMD

Opteron 6378

The Opteron 6378 is manufactured by AMD. It was released in 5 November 2012 (13 years ago). It is based on the Abu Dhabi (2012) architecture. It features 16 cores and 16 threads. Base frequency is 2.4 GHz, with boost up to 3.3 GHz. L3 cache: 8 MB (total). L2 cache: 16 MB. Built on 32 nm process technology. Socket: G34. Thermal design power (TDP): 115 Watt. Memory support: DDR3. Passmark benchmark score: 5,889 points. Launch price was $396.

Processing Power

The Ryzen 3 PRO 3300U packs 4 cores / 4 threads, while the Opteron 6378 offers 16 cores / 16 threads — the Opteron 6378 has 12 more cores. Boost clocks reach 3.5 GHz on the Ryzen 3 PRO 3300U versus 3.3 GHz on the Opteron 6378 — a 5.9% clock advantage for the Ryzen 3 PRO 3300U (base: 2.1 GHz vs 2.4 GHz). The Ryzen 3 PRO 3300U uses the Picasso (2019−2022) architecture (12 nm), while the Opteron 6378 uses Abu Dhabi (2012) (32 nm). In PassMark, the Ryzen 3 PRO 3300U scores 5,831 against the Opteron 6378's 5,889 — a 1% lead for the Opteron 6378. L3 cache: 4 MB (total) on the Ryzen 3 PRO 3300U vs 8 MB (total) on the Opteron 6378.

Memory & Platform

The Ryzen 3 PRO 3300U uses the FP5 socket (PCIe 3.0), while the Opteron 6378 uses G34 (PCIe 2.0) — making them incompatible on the same motherboard.
